Block and Estate Management is about the minutia done well: the role of a Managing Agent is technical, administrative, practical and political. It takes joined up thinking from a multi-disciplined team with one eye on the strategic long term plan and with sufficient resource to react to whatever is necessary day-to-day: the skills that block and estate management spans are: politics, building pathology, finance, legal knowhow and of course customer service too.

As a leading Managing Agent, we are a one-stop-property shop. We understand that our role is sometimes signposting Clients to get expert advice and supporting them to interpret such advice and make decisions. We support and help owners reach out to government and other local services where matters are beyond our day-to-day block management remit.

History of Dollis Hill

Dollis Hill, located in northwest London, has a rich history that dates back to the early 19th century when it was primarily rural land within the Brent Reservoir estate. As London expanded, the area began to develop into a residential neighbourhood during the late 19th century, with new homes and infrastructure emerging as part of the suburb's growth. One of the most notable figures associated with Dollis Hill is Will Crooks, a prominent Labour politician, who lived there in the early 1900s and played a significant role in local and national politics.

Throughout the 20th century, Dollis Hill continued to evolve, with the construction of additional housing, schools, and parks to accommodate its growing population. Its proximity to key areas like Kilburn and Willesden further bolstered its appeal. Today, Dollis Hill blends its historical charm with modern amenities, making it a popular area for families and professionals. The area is known for its good transport links, green spaces, and strong sense of community, offering a perfect balance between historical significance and contemporary living. With its mix of period homes and newer developments, Dollis Hill remains an attractive and thriving neighborhood in northwest London.

Things to do in Dollis Hill

Dollis Hill, located in northwest London within the London Borough of Brent, is a peaceful and green residential area known for its spacious parks and strong community spirit. It offers a variety of cultural and outdoor activities that cater to all ages and interests. Here are some top things to do in Dollis Hill:

  • Gladstone Park in Dollis Hill is an expansive public park with tennis courts, a children’s playground, a pond, and a café, perfect for family outings and relaxing walks.

  • Dollis Hill Tube Station in Dollis Hill provides easy access to central London and surrounding areas, making it a convenient transport hub.

  • The Mapesbury Dell in Dollis Hill is a hidden community garden offering a peaceful retreat with well-maintained greenery, ideal for quiet walks.

  • Dollis Hill Synagogue in Dollis Hill is a historic building reflecting the area's rich Jewish heritage with unique architecture.

  • The Grange Museum in Dollis Hill showcases local history with interesting exhibits, set within the beautiful Gladstone Park.

  • Karmarama Café in Dollis Hill is a cozy spot within Gladstone Park serving breakfasts, coffee, and homemade cakes.

  • The Queensbury Pub in Dollis Hill is a popular gastropub offering seasonal menus, a great wine and ale selection, and live jazz sessions.

  • Sparkle O'Hara in Dollis Hill is a boutique selling vintage and new clothing, jewelry, and accessories for unique fashion finds.

  • Deli Beira in Dollis Hill is a continental deli offering a variety of fresh produce, cheeses, and meats.

  • Revital Health Food Store in Dollis Hill offers organic products, supplements, and eco-friendly goods for health-conscious shoppers.

  • The Lexi Cinema in Dollis Hill is an independent volunteer-run cinema showing mainstream films and live opera in a community setting.

  • Brent Reservoir near Dollis Hill is a scenic spot ideal for birdwatching, walking, and enjoying nature.

  • Neasden Temple (BAPS Shri Swaminarayan Mandir) near Dollis Hill is one of the largest Hindu temples outside India, renowned for its stunning architecture.

  • Local Art and Culture in Dollis Hill can be enjoyed through community events, workshops, and exhibitions held throughout the year.

 

Dollis Hill offers a wonderful mix of green spaces, cultural experiences, and community activities, making it a pleasant place to explore and unwind.
